Fugitive rabbi's bail bid continues
Updated | By Jacaranda FM News
The bail application for fugitive rabbi Eliezer Berland continues today in the Randburg Magistrate's court.

Yesterday the application was postponed due to bail arguments not being completed.
The State has submitted documents form Interpol to substantiate their position against bail because he is a flight risk.
The affidavit states Berland is wanted in Israel for sexual crimes, listing incidents of Berland touching a number of women indecently.
He allegedly also assaulted the husband of one of the women. The affidavit also states that Berland had fled from the law before.
The defence denied that Berland was a fugitive of justice. They said he was in the country to expand his Jewish teachings amongst black people.
